Brunei is enacting a new strict Islamic law making gay sex and adultery punishable by death. Shahiran Shahrani, who fled Brunei in October, joins Full Circle to discuss what he calls “horrendous” laws coming into force. Tune in on Facebook Watch at 6:25pET

Brunei strengthens its Islamic lawsThe laws, elements of which were first adopted in 2014 and which have been rolled out in phases since then, will be fully implemented from next week, the prime minister's office said in a statement on Saturday.
